对象存储服务采用的存储机制,对象存储数据调度策略研究,支持机制与意义探讨
- 综合资讯
- 2024-11-09 22:47:23
- 0
对象存储服务采用独特的存储机制,研究其数据调度策略以优化服务性能。支持机制探讨旨在提升存储效率和稳定性,同时强调其在数据安全、访问速度等方面的意义。...
对象存储服务采用独特的存储机制,研究其数据调度策略以优化服务性能。支持机制探讨旨在提升存储效率和稳定性,同时强调其在数据安全、访问速度等方面的意义。
随着信息技术的飞速发展,大数据时代已经来临,海量数据的存储与处理成为各行业关注的焦点,对象存储作为一种新兴的存储技术,因其高效、可靠、可扩展等特点,在云计算、大数据、物联网等领域得到了广泛应用,数据调度策略作为对象存储系统中的重要组成部分,对于提高系统性能、降低成本、保障数据安全等方面具有重要意义,本文将对对象存储支持的数据调度策略进行深入研究,探讨其支持机制及研究意义。
对象存储概述
1、1 定义
对象存储是一种基于对象的数据存储技术,将数据存储在由元数据、数据、访问控制信息组成的对象中,对象存储系统由多个存储节点组成,每个节点负责存储一部分对象,对象存储具有以下特点:
(1)分布式存储:对象存储系统采用分布式存储架构,将数据分散存储在多个节点上,提高了系统的可靠性和可扩展性。
(2)高性能:对象存储系统通过多节点并行访问,提高了数据读写速度。
(3)高可靠性:对象存储系统采用冗余存储策略,确保数据安全。
(4)易于管理:对象存储系统提供统一的接口,方便用户管理和访问数据。
1、2 存储机制
对象存储系统采用以下存储机制:
(1)对象标识:每个对象都有一个唯一的标识符,用于访问和管理对象。
(2)对象存储空间:对象存储空间是存储对象数据的容器,包括多个存储节点。
(3)元数据:元数据描述对象属性,如对象大小、创建时间、访问权限等。
(4)数据副本:对象存储系统采用冗余存储策略,确保数据安全。
数据调度策略研究
2、1 调度策略分类
根据调度目标,数据调度策略可分为以下几类:
(1)负载均衡:通过将请求分配到不同的存储节点,实现负载均衡,提高系统性能。
(2)数据冗余:通过在多个存储节点上存储数据副本,提高数据可靠性。
(3)数据迁移:根据存储节点的性能、负载等因素,将数据迁移到更合适的节点。
(4)故障恢复:在存储节点发生故障时,自动恢复数据,确保系统正常运行。
2、2 调度策略支持机制
(1)分布式哈希表(DHT):DHT是一种分布式数据结构,用于存储对象标识与存储节点之间的关系,通过DHT,可以快速定位对象存储节点,提高数据访问速度。
(2)负载感知算法:根据存储节点的负载情况,动态调整数据分布,实现负载均衡。
(3)冗余存储策略:采用多副本、纠删码等冗余存储策略,提高数据可靠性。
(4)故障检测与恢复机制:通过监控存储节点状态,及时发现故障并进行恢复。
2、3 调度策略研究意义
(1)提高系统性能:通过负载均衡、数据迁移等策略,提高系统处理能力,满足用户需求。
(2)降低成本:通过优化存储资源分配,降低存储成本。
(3)保障数据安全:通过冗余存储、故障恢复等策略,确保数据安全。
(4)提高系统可扩展性:通过动态调整数据分布,适应系统规模的变化。
本文对对象存储支持的数据调度策略进行了深入研究,分析了调度策略的分类、支持机制及研究意义,随着对象存储技术的不断发展,数据调度策略在提高系统性能、降低成本、保障数据安全等方面具有重要意义,随着人工智能、物联网等领域的快速发展,对象存储数据调度策略将面临更多挑战,需要不断优化和创新。
本文链接:https://www.zhitaoyun.cn/718028.html
发表评论